💎一站式轻松地调用各大LLM模型接口,支持GPT4、智谱、豆包、星火、月之暗面及文生图、文生视频 广告
* **column: *[Array] 列配置*** gis-table的列配置完全参照iView-UI的columns的配置规则. (详见 [http://v1.iviewui.com/components/table#API](http://v1.iviewui.com/components/table%23API)) 在此基础上,gis-table的column还提供两种参数来节省开发者的编码量 1. dict:字典,声明之后组件会根据前端缓存的指定字典,将table内原来的数据作为字典值转化为指定文字。 2. format:格式化,支持 日期格式(yyyy-MM-dd || yyyy年MM月dd日 等等)、数字格式(.000 后面0的个数表示小数点精确的位数)、经纬度(lon|lat)。 **注意,dict与format不能共用,同时二者都是基于render封装的,因此优先级低于render。** 用例 : ``` [ { title: "审核状态", key: " authStatus", align: "align", fixed: "right", minWidth: 30, dict: $SYSCONST.dict.auditStatus, //字典值 }, { title: "操作", key: "action", align: "center", fixed: "right", width: 100, render: (h, params) => {  return h("div", [ h( "Button",  { props: { type: "primary", size: "small",                }, style: { marginRight: "5px", },                   on: { click: () => { this.handleBtnAudit(params.row); }, } }, "审核"), ` ]); } } ] ``` <br /> * **config: *[Object] 基础配置,详情请见 三、自定义表单组件的第2节周跟的基础配置*** 数据结构: ``` table: { page: {}, search: {}, button: {}, } ``` <br /> * **search: *[Array] 查询条件配置*** 查询条件的查询框是由gis-form绘制出来的,所以这里的search参数相当于gis-form里面的rule。 <br /> * **pageable: *[Boolean] 是否开启分页,优先级高于config showPage。*** <br /> * **searchable: *[Boolean] 是否开启查询功能,优先级高于config showSearch。*** <br /> * **buttons: *[Array] 按钮配置*** 用例: ``` button: [ { key: "edit", //唯一标识 title: "审核", //按钮文字 icon: "md-eye", //按钮图标 type: "primary", //按钮状态 (primary/success/warning/error) }, { key: "show", title: "查看", icon: "md-book", } ] ``` *按钮事件并不写在buttons里,而是根据key生成。例如,新增按钮的key是“add”,那么我们想要监听新增按钮的点击事件,应该监听,handleBtnAdd这个事件。 按钮事件命名规则: handleBtn+ 按钮的key首字母大写* <br /> * **height: *[String] table高度,auto时则自定义占满屏幕。*** <br /> * **fetchName: *[String] 表格数据后台请求接口。*** <br /> * **isJpa: *[Boolean] 后台接口是否为Jpa接口,默认为否,后台接口基本上都是使用MP开发。***